Christians ignoring the Bible have no Right to Expect a special Word from God

They may get that "Word"..... God is good all the time, and shows readily for the willing and the eager to know Him.... but it doesn't seem that there is a right to demand it from God.

To expect it.

I have been around conversations lately where so many Christians were searching for their own, personal "word" from God. Why God doesn't talk back. And even while not searching deeply for Him, there was a universal expectation that God would build on their lives. Give them answers.

I know that we must be In the Word - because the Word of God is Holy, and It is Our Instruction. Our Guide. And I am pretty sure that God doesn't build and support on sand but only on His Foundation. So how can people expect God to do or perform or hear them when they are not running towards Him? 

Therefore whosoever heareth these sayings of mine, and doeth them, I will liken him unto a wise man, which built his house upon a rock: And the rain descended, and the floods came, and the winds blew, and beat upon that house; and it fell not: for it was founded upon a rock. And every one that heareth these sayings of mine, and doeth them not, shall be likened unto a foolish man, which built his house upon the sand: And the rain descended, and the floods came, and the winds blew, and beat upon that house; and it fell: and great was the fall of it. Matthew 7:24-27


Christ is the Rock of our Lives: Indeed, the center of civilization. How can anyone expect a WORD when they are not building on The Rock. We have to thirst for it, we have to want it. This got me to looking into verses that discuss hearing the Word of God. This book, this Bible...is so alive.

Colossians 3:16

Let the word of Christ richly dwell within you, with all wisdom teaching and admonishing one another with psalms and hymns and spiritual songs, singing with thankfulness in your hearts to God.

John 8:31

So Jesus was saying to those Jews who had believed Him, “If you continue in My word, then you are truly disciples of Mine;

John 15:7

If you abide in Me, and My words abide in you, ask whatever you wish, and it will be done for you.

1 Thessalonians 2:13

For this reason we also constantly thank God that when you received the word of God which you heard from us, you accepted it not as the word of men, but for what it really is, the word of God, which also performs its work in you who believe

1 John 2:14

I have written to you, fathers, because you know Him who has been from the beginning. I have written to you, young men, because you are strong, and the word of God abides in you, and you have overcome the evil one.

The Word reaches us when we reach for it. I started out saying I can't understand the Bible when I read it. Now I know: I ask for Guidance as I read. And, I also have teachers online that I have come to discern and respect that go deep into the Word. And, I have my favorite Pastors that I am blessed to be able to be in person and live with a community. Seeking for my own Word - every day, every decision, every time.

I am late in putting my full trust in Jesus, but I am all in. I am listening. I am leaning in. And I am reading everyday, out loud.
